Problem
The documentation (dump and correlated LTP joblog) show that an abend 0039 occurs 5 seconds after LTMOA job is started.
USER COMPLETION CODE=0039

It is due to the SORT parms an ALL MEMORY sort is being done and the amount of memory is insufficient:
DFSORT steps shows
DFSORT steps shows
ICE039A H INSUFFICIENT MAIN STORAGE - ADD AT LEAST 16K BYTES

Cause
The main issue is that DFSORT is trying to do the sort all in MEMORY instead of using the sort work file.
Resolving The Problem
REMOVE the REGION parameter and increase the size of the SORT WORK
datasets. DFSORT APARs mentioned below should be applied.
.
The ICE039A that will be resolved by the APAR PH19006.
------------
PH19006 has this LOCAL FIX:
LOCAL FIX:
BYPASS/CIRCUMVENTION:
This intermittent ICE039A was circumvented by passing DFSORT
the MAINSIZE parameter at run-time:
.
//DFSPARM DD *
OPTION MAINSIZE=nM
------------
.
In APAR PH25574 is reported:
------------
If you have a single job with an ICE039A message and you want to
**TEMPORARILY** turn off the use of ZHPF for DFSORT Sort Work
Data Sets you can do so with the following JCL:
//DFSPARM DD *
DEBUG $ZEXCP$=OFF
/*
...
------------
Try the DFSPARM bypasses could help if the APAR is still not applied.
